Julia Smith Literal 1876 Translation:
And Jephthah will vow a vow to Jehovah, and he will say, If giving, thou wilt give the sons of Ammon into my hand,

LITV Translation:
And Jephthah vowed a vow to Jehovah, and said, If You will indeed give the sons of Ammon into my hand,

Brenton Septuagint Translation:
And Jephthah vowed a vow to the Lord, and said, If thou wilt indeed deliver the children of Ammon into my hand,
